Output c650caa616565a448686a73ce268a320ec2a68063fdec19d277b70af19d43e6c:10

value
2330915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67df2beea3f585306bf1410180fd2ae4821c71e9 OP_EQUAL
address
3BAEsY8jwMUMnLMFQmb4E7yy71uEiYiwdw
transaction
c650caa616565a448686a73ce268a320ec2a68063fdec19d277b70af19d43e6c
confirmations
470456
spent
true